Description
- The present invention, an improved closure device for furniture doors, relates to a novel and original closure structure which can be applied in furniture in general, such as doors of cupboards, kitchen furniture, bathroom furniture, etc... formed by a mechanism with two supports that are inserted into one another under pressure.
- The present invention therefore facilitates assembling pieces of furniture with folding leaves as it simplifies the installation process, while at the same time due to its special features it involves a highly durable device with magnificent functional features at a highly competitive cost.
- Different closure systems for folding leaves used in furniture elements are currently known. Magnetic closures, which are very popular, should be mentioned among them, in which the closure element is carried out by means of a support integrating a magnetic magnet, whereas a metallic element is located in the folding leaf. Upon closing, both elements are joined together by magnetic attraction.
- A drawback of these systems is their progressive wear over time, losing functional capacities, while at the same they involve a considerable cost.
- In addition, other systems are known in which the closure is integrated in the hinge itself, as is the case of cup hinges which are commonly used in kitchen furniture. In addition to involving a complex and expensive element, these hinges have a complex installation, the use of milling machines and other specialized tools being required.
- Likewise, in the case of corner doors, the wear occurring in the closure systems is high, as they undergo greater mechanical wear. The present invention precisely forms a system which is mainly created for the closure of combined corner doors, where it is possible to rub against the contiguous door in the closing action, creating the need for the design of the closure part with a roller which it would touch before anything else, preventing said rubbing.
- The present invention therefore represents a technical solution which, in addition to being novel, is easy to manufacture and implement in the furniture assembly, giving high performance, greater than that of the other existing alternatives in the state of the art.
- Due to the foregoing, the improved closure device for furniture doors described below is formed by a structure of two parts or supports which can be inserted into another with an L-shaped profile, with one of their sides provided with means for fixing same to the smooth surface of the inner leaf or wall of the piece of furniture in which it is to be placed and the other surface finished in each support in a system for the coupling between both. In this device, the mentioned means for fixing same to the leaf or wall surfaces of the pieces of furniture are formed by a set of holes provided on the surface of each mentioned L-shaped profile, whereas the mentioned system for the coupling between both supports is formed by a clamp or housing and roller support, the latter being able to be inserted-into the former when one is placed over the other.
- In addition, in the described device, respective rollers are located in both supports, the first roller at the end of the mentioned housing by means of a slot provided for that purpose and the second roller supported by its fixing base, both rollers being free to rotate about their respective axes. The existence of such rollers considerably increases the functional durability and the performance of the closure, device, as rubbing and the subsequent wear between the parts are prevented.
- Furthermore, the mentioned support structures are made of plastic or sufficiently flexible material, the structure, due to its actual design, being able to functionally absorb slight placement deviations of both supports. Likewise, this feature allows ensuring a gentle and effective pressure between the two supports, such that a suitable closure pressure is formed which is enough to keep the leaf closed and which, however, is easy to overcome in order to open it. The strength of the clamp will furthermore be greater the more material it has and the more rigid said material is.
- Likewise, at least some of the holes provided on the surface of each mentioned L-shaped profile are provided with certain clearance to adjust their position in the assembly tasks, allowing a fine adjustment so that the suitable gap may exist between the leaves of the doors:
- Finally, a version of this device has been provided in which there is a pressure regulator formed by a clamp provided with an inner spring in one of the supports. With this regulator the closure pressure is more evenly regulated in a simple and effective manner. This system is mainly created for the closure of combined corner doors, where it is possible to rub against the contiguous door in the closing action, creating the need for the design of the closure part with a roller which it would touch before anything else, preventing said rubbing.

Claims (5)
- An improved closure device for furniture doors, formed by a structure with two parts or supports which can be inserted into one another with an L-shaped profile, with one of their sides provided with means for fixing same to the smooth surface of the inner leaf or wall of the piece of furniture in which it is to be placed and the other surface finished in each support in a system for the coupling between both, being characterized in that the mentioned means for fixing same to the leaf or wall surfaces of the pieces of furniture are formed by a set of holes (3) provided on the surface of each mentioned L-shaped profile, whereas the mentioned system for the coupling between both supports (1, 2) is formed by a clamp or housing (4) and roller support (5), the latter being able to be inserted into the former when one is placed over the other.
- An improved closure device for furniture doors according to claim 1, characterized in that respective rollers (7, 6) are located in both supports (1, 2), the first roller (7) at the end of the mentioned housing (4) by means of a slot provided for that purpose and the second roller (6) supported by its fixing base (5), both rollers being free to rotate about their respective axes.
- An improved closure device for furniture doors according to at least one of the previous claims, characterized in that the mentioned support structures are made of material provided with certain flexibility.
- An improved closure device for furniture doors according to at least one of the previous claims, characterized in that at least some of the holes (3) provided on the surface of each mentioned L-shaped profile are provided with certain clearance to adjust their position in the assembly tasks.
- An improved closure device for furniture doors according to at least one of the previous claims, characterized in that there is a pressure regulator (8) formed by a clamp provided with an inner spring in one of the supports.
